How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- stating the more general rule that “arbitration agreements are . . . to be broadly construed . . . in favor of coverage” and rejecting the assertion that “an agreement to arbitrate a dispute must pre-date the actions giving rise to the dispute” to be enforceable
- use of language “arising out of your business or this agreement shall be submitted to arbitration” evidenced intent to cover more than just matters set forth in the contract
